Dilly Beans

Add dill, clove garlic and pepper in 2-quart jar.Boil vinegar, water and salt.Pour over beans to fill jar.Cover and seal.Let sit 4 to 6 weeks.The longer the better.Serve chilled like pickles. ...

Orange Sweet Potatoes

Boil sweet potatoes in skins until tender.Cut in 1/2-inch slices.Arrange in greased shallow pan.Combine remaining ingredients; cook until thick.Pour over potatoes.Cover.Bake 20 minutes at 350\u00b0. ...
